Danuta Gleed Literary Award
2014
The Danuta Gleed Literary Award is given annually for the best first collection of published short fiction in English, written by a Canadian citizen or landed immigrant.

2014
- Paul Carlucci – The Secret Life of Fission
Runners-up:
- Astrid Blodgett – You Haven't Changed a Bit
- Eufemia Fantetti – A Recipe for Disaster & Other Unlikely Tales of Love
Also shortlisted:
- Théodora Armstrong – Clear Skies, No Wind, 100% Visibility
- Lisa Bird-Wilson – Just Pretending
